Amazon.com description: Product Description: Patterned after the bestselling The Complete Adult Psychotherapy Treatment Planner, this invaluable sourcebook brings a proven treatment planning system to the group therapy treatment arena. It contains all the necessary elements for developing focused, formal treatment plans for group therapy that satisfy all of the demands of HMOs, managed care companies, third-party payers, and state and federal review agencies. Organized around 28 main presenting problems ranging from domestic violence, to chronic pain, to codependence, to parenting problems, this book features:
- Over 1,000 well-crafted, clear statements that describe the problem and the long-term goals and short-term objectives of treatment, as well as clinically tested treatment options
- A sample treatment plan that can be emulated in writing plans that meet all requirements of third-party payers and accrediting agencies, including the JCAHO and the NCQA
- A quick-reference format that allows you to easily locate treatment plan components by behavioral problem or DSM-IV⢠diagnosis
- Large workbook-style pages affording plenty of space to record your own customized definitions, goals, objectives, and interventions
